What Actually Happens After the Hospital Call - Full Episode 6
In this episode of the Aging Options Retirement Show, Rajiv Nagaich explains why even well-meaning families with savings, legal documents, and strong relationships can still feel overwhelmed when a health crisis suddenly forces urgent care decisions.
He shows how the real breakdown doesn’t come from lack of love or effort, but from lack of guidance—leaving families to navigate a complex healthcare system under pressure, often leading to rushed decisions, unnecessary facility placements, and long-term consequences that could have been avoided.
This episode introduces geriatric care managers as the missing piece in retirement planning—professionals who assess, coordinate, advocate, and guide families through care decisions—so retirees can stay at home longer, maintain independence, and avoid becoming a burden on the people they love.
